## Polkadot: Redefining Interoperability in the Blockchain Landscape
Introduction
In the rapidly evolving world of blockchain technology, interoperability has emerged as a crucial aspect. Polkadot, a pioneering blockchain protocol, stands tall as an innovative solution addressing the fragmentation and isolation that plague many cryptocurrencies. With its groundbreaking design, Polkadot aims to foster a diverse and interconnected ecosystem, enabling seamless communication and collaboration between independent blockchains.
Polkadot's Architectural Framework
At the heart of Polkadot lies a unique architectural framework comprising three fundamental components:
* Relay Chain: The central backbone of the network, the Relay Chain serves as the primary data structure and consensus mechanism. It coordinates the communication and validation of transactions across all connected parachains.
* Parachains: These independent, application-specific blockchains leverage Polkadot's shared security and interoperability capabilities. Each parachain caters to a specific use case or application, such as decentralized finance, identity management, or supply chain tracking.
* Bridges: Acting as gateways, bridges enable the interoperability of Polkadot with external blockchains. They facilitate the seamless transfer of assets and data between Polkadot's parachains and other blockchain ecosystems.
Benefits of Interoperability
The interoperability provided by Polkadot offers numerous benefits to its users and the broader blockchain community:
* Enhanced Scalability: By distributing processing across multiple parachains, Polkadot can handle a higher transaction volume than any single blockchain, resulting in improved scalability and reduced network congestion.
* Improved Security: Polkadot's shared security model leverages the collective security of the Relay Chain, significantly enhancing the resilience of all connected parachains to malicious attacks or malfunctions.
* Increased Flexibility and Innovation: Polkadot's modular architecture enables the creation of specialized parachains tailored to specific requirements, fostering innovation and offering a wider range of blockchain solutions.
* Lower Transaction Costs: By sharing resources and infrastructure, Polkadot can reduce transaction fees compared to operating separate blockchains, benefiting users and application developers.
Real-World Applications
Polkadot's interoperability capabilities hold immense potential across various industries and applications, including:
* Decentralized Finance (DeFi): Facilitating the seamless transfer of assets between different DeFi platforms and enabling the development of cross-chain financial applications.
* Supply Chain Management: Providing a transparent and auditable platform for tracking goods throughout the supply chain, ensuring product authenticity and preventing counterfeiting.
* Identity Management: Creating a secure and interoperable system for managing digital identities, eliminating the need for multiple accounts and providing improved privacy and control over personal information.
